the all-new '08 CTS is nearly here, featuring a completely redesigned exterior and a pure luxury interior. Motivated by an advanced, available 304hp Direct Injection V6 engine, the all-new '08 CTS provides brisk acceleration to complement its styling. It also touts hand-cut and -sewn interior features and a host of available features including Bose® 5.1 Cabin Surround® Sound, 40 gig hard drive media storage, and UltraView sunroof. It's all the luxury you deserve, with the performance you've come to expect from Cadillac.

This is exactly what I said, which makes sense since I'm using the same source. Note the AWD in note 1. That's for all-wheel-drive. And note 2 says that the brakes are only included with RWD when the pricier Summer Tire Package is also ordered, not with PDR alone.

If you order a RWD car with PDR and not the Summer Tire package, you do not get the performance brakes and are not charged the extra $395.
